When it comes to technology, the genuine NTAG215 chip is a highlight of these cards. With 504 bytes of memory and password-protected authentication, they offer a solid level of security for data transfer. I appreciate the high scan strength and the ease of programming. The option to set the cards as read-only or to allow repeated edits is particularly beneficial. It means I can customize the cards for different occasions without the worry of losing essential data.
One of the most impressive features is how these cards operate. Simply hovering an NFC-enabled phone over the card sends data directly to it without needing any internal power source. This effortless sharing capability can be used for everything from sharing social media profiles to connecting to WiFi networks.
